云服务器存储如何实现,云服务器存储原理,技术架构与实现解析
- 综合资讯
- 2024-11-19 14:47:39
- 2

云服务器存储通过分布式存储技术实现,原理是将数据分散存储在多个服务器上,提高可靠性和扩展性。技术架构包括数据复制、负载均衡、数据冗余等,实现解析需考虑数据一致性、性能优...
云服务器存储通过分布式存储技术实现,原理是将数据分散存储在多个服务器上,提高可靠性和扩展性。技术架构包括数据复制、负载均衡、数据冗余等,实现解析需考虑数据一致性、性能优化、安全性等因素。
随着互联网技术的飞速发展,云计算已成为当今信息技术领域的主流趋势,云服务器存储作为云计算的核心组成部分,为用户提供高效、便捷的数据存储服务,本文将深入探讨云服务器存储的原理,包括技术架构、存储类型、数据分布、备份与恢复等方面,以帮助读者全面了解云服务器存储的实现方式。
云服务器存储技术架构
1、分布式存储架构
云服务器存储采用分布式存储架构,将数据分散存储在多个节点上,实现数据的高可用性和高性能,分布式存储架构主要包括以下几种:
(1)P2P(Peer-to-Peer)对等网络:数据存储在所有节点上,每个节点既是客户端又是服务器,实现数据的共享和访问。
(2)集群存储:通过多个存储节点组成一个集群,实现数据的分布式存储和访问。
(3)分布式文件系统:如HDFS(Hadoop Distributed File System)、Ceph等,将数据存储在多个节点上,通过文件系统进行统一管理和访问。
2、存储节点架构
云服务器存储节点主要包括以下几种:
(1)存储服务器:负责存储数据的硬件设备,如硬盘、SSD等。
(2)存储控制器:负责管理存储服务器,包括数据读写、存储节点间的通信等。
(3)网络设备:如交换机、路由器等,负责存储节点间的数据传输。
云服务器存储类型
1、冷存储
冷存储主要针对非实时数据,如归档、备份等,冷存储具有以下特点:
(1)存储成本较低:采用传统的硬盘存储,成本相对较低。
(2)访问速度较慢:由于数据分布在多个节点上,访问速度相对较慢。
2、热存储
热存储主要针对实时数据,如数据库、缓存等,热存储具有以下特点:
(1)存储性能较高:采用SSD等高性能存储设备,访问速度较快。
(2)存储成本较高:相比冷存储,热存储的成本较高。
3、分布式存储
分布式存储结合了冷存储和热存储的优点,将数据存储在多个节点上,实现数据的高可用性和高性能,分布式存储适用于各类场景,如大数据、云计算等。
云服务器存储数据分布
1、数据副本
为了提高数据的安全性,云服务器存储采用数据副本技术,将数据复制到多个节点上,数据副本分为以下几种:
(1)全副本:将数据完整地复制到多个节点上。
(2)部分副本:只复制数据的一部分到多个节点上。
2、数据一致性
云服务器存储通过以下技术保证数据一致性:
(1)版本控制:记录数据的版本信息,确保数据的一致性。
(2)锁机制:在数据访问过程中,通过锁机制保证数据的一致性。
云服务器存储备份与恢复
1、数据备份
云服务器存储采用以下备份策略:
(1)全备份:定期对整个存储系统进行备份。
(2)增量备份:只备份自上次备份以来发生变化的文件。
(3)差异备份:备份自上次全备份以来发生变化的文件。
2、数据恢复
云服务器存储支持以下数据恢复方式:
(1)按需恢复:用户根据需求,选择恢复特定数据。
(2)全量恢复:恢复整个存储系统的数据。
(3)部分恢复:恢复部分数据。
云服务器存储作为云计算的核心组成部分,为用户提供高效、便捷的数据存储服务,本文从技术架构、存储类型、数据分布、备份与恢复等方面,深入解析了云服务器存储的原理,了解云服务器存储的实现方式,有助于用户更好地选择和应用云服务器存储服务,随着云计算技术的不断发展,云服务器存储将发挥越来越重要的作用。
本文链接:https://zhitaoyun.cn/948994.html
发表评论